Parliamentary Paper No. 86 Report and Recommendation of the Maori Land Court on Petition No. 240 of 1932, of Hori Tupaea and four others, praying for relief in connection with Whanganui-o-rotu or Napier Inner Harbour, and their right of property therein. I am directed to report that in the opinion of the Committee this paper should be referred to the Government for consideration. 11th August, 1948. No. 15—Petition of H. E. Kendall and Another, of Hokianga. Praying for relief in regard to the estate of E. G. Kendall, deceased. I am directed to report that the Committee has no recommendation to make regarding this petition. 11th August, 1948. [Translation] Pitihana Kama 15 a H. E. Kendall raua ko tetahi atu, o Hokianga.
